Office Name Date of Appointment By Whom Appointed and Under What Instrument Annual Salary (Dollars) Fund from Which Salary is Paid Remarks
POLICE MAGISTRATES' OFFICE
Police Magistrate and Coroner H. E. Wodehouse, C.M.G. 15th January 1881 Secretary of State's Despatch No. 14 of 1881 7,800.00 (1)
First Clerk W. M. B. Arthur 12th February 1887 S. of S. Desp. No. 52 of 1887 2,232.00 (2)
Second Clerk Ng Kwai-shang 17th January 1883 S. of S. Desp. No. 135 of 1884 1,728.00
Third Clerk Cheung Tsoi 7th November 1897 S. of S. Desp. No. 26 of 1898 840.00
Fourth Clerk & Assistant Hindustani Interpreter S. Alli Bux 1st March 1897 S. of S. Desp. No. 78 of 1897 648.00
Fifth Clerk A. A. Alves 1st July 1898 The Governor, by C.S.O. 1476 of 1898 432.00
Chinese & Hindustani Interpreter M. Hoosen 9th May 1898 The Governor, by C.S.O. 349 of 1899 900.00
Punti and Hakka Interpreter Tsang Hoi-tong 11th May 1898 The Governor, by C.O. 1184 of 1898 652.00
Interpreter N. G. Nolan 7th April 1891 The Governor, by C.S.O. 18 of 1891 1,200.00
Chinese Clerk and Shroff Chan Chi 7th November 1897 S. of S. Desp. No. 26 of 1899 432.00
Clerk & Chinese Interpreter to the Magistrate acting as Coroner Cheung Tsoi
Usher and Process Server Chan Yuk-shau
Assistant Usher and Process Server Li Lai-chün
Summoning Officer to Magistrate acting as Coroner European Constable
Chinese Messenger Ngai Sui 7th March 1893 The Governor, by C.S.'s Letter No. 343 of 1893 288.00
11th May 1898 The Governor, by C.S.O. 1184 of 1898 360.00
1st June 1898 Do. 288.00
Lo A-ling 1st March 1898 / 1st March 1889 Schedule of Establishment 96.00
Chow Kam 8th February 1897 Do. 72.00
Scavenger Leung Tsoi 1st September 1895 Do. 60.00
European Constable Do. 600.00
Chinese Constable Do. 132.00

Carried forward .... $ 473,578.00

REMARKS

(1) On sick leave from 26th February and pensioned off on 26th July. Commander W. C. H. Hastings acted as Police Magistrate and Coroner from 26th February to 31st December, and drew half salary of the office from 26th May to 31st August at $325 per month, and from 1st September to 31st December at $250 per month.

(2) Full salary of office $2,592, but deduction made of $360 per annum as value of quarters. Mr. C. W. Duggan acted as First Clerk from 1st March to 31st December, and drew half salary of the office from 1st July to 31st December.
